Opening Prayers/Prayers of Adoration on Servanthood
O Merciful God, who came in Jesus Christ with saving power to a world that walked in darkness and in the shadow of death, we praise and bless you for all those your servants who helped prepare the way for his appearing, and for those who received him and grave to him the worship of their hearts and lives. For prophets who in the face of tyranny declared your truth and your righteousness, for psalmists who in days of gloom still believed in your great goodness and sang praises unto your name, and for innumerable regular saints who waited in patience and unfailing hope for the manifestation of your glory, we raise to you our grateful praise. Grant, we ask you, that we in this time may show forth your salvation.
Help us to put away all untruthfulness and all selfishness and greed, all malice and prejudice and cowardice. Let your Holy Spirit cleanse us from all our sins, and teach us to love one another even as you dost love us, that we may make manifest in our lives what you can do for your faithful people; through Jesus Christ our Lord. Amen.
Ernest Fremont Tittle, Language modernized by Stuart Strachan Jr.
Opening Prayer based on 1 Corinthians 12
Holy One, Giver of every good and perfect gift
It is your great grace that offers us salvation
It is grace upon grace that gives us the chance to join you in your saving work
You trust us that much
You empower us that far
Reveal our spiritual gifts
Reveal our calling in this time and place
so we may fulfill it together
so we may fulfill it for the common good
so we may honor you and one another
Holy One, convince us of our value and purpose,
Assure us of our place in your Body and our place in your plan
Use us for your glory, now and forever. Amen.
